				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I&#8217;m on a mascara kick lately, can you tell? I have even more to share with you, so keep a lookout for that. But today we&#8217;re talking about the new Flamed Out mascara, which gives a really natural, yet glam look. If you like noticeable eyelashes without a &#8220;fake&#8221; look to them, you&#8217;ll want to take a closer look. <span id="more-32769"></span></p>
<p>The key to this product is the super cool brush. The flared out ends grab more of the smaller hairs on the inner and outer corners of the eye, giving you more noticeable lashes. I will say that I&#8217;ve seen a lot of mascaras try and do this trick without much success, but this brush seems to be different &#8211; it does a great job of grabbing those little hairs.</p>
<p>The formula is definitely on the thick side, and is meant to be used for dramatic eye looks. Most people will love one coat, but there are others like me, who just have to take it to the limit and pile on three coats. Whatever you do, make sure you have an eyelash comb/brush to brush out any clumps.</p>
<p>I didn&#8217;t have any weird flaking or raccoon eye issues at all. It stayed put until I took it off.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Do you ever check out the Target clearance racks? I don&#8217;t know exactly what their system is, but every now and again I can find some really cool stuff to try for not very much cash. This is one of those products. I found a double pack of <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F11BUOj9&sref=rss">Maybelline New York&#8217;s Volum&#8217; Express Mega Plush</a> mascara for less than $5, so I grabbed that and promptly put it in my desk drawer only to forget about it. <span id="more-32753"></span></p>
<p>But there is a happy ending! I found it recently, and decided to give it a whirl. This is a seriously good mascara, further reinforcing my opinion that there are so many good drugstore mascaras now, that you should only need to purchase an expensive one <em>because you want to</em>. Not because they are just so much better.</p>
<p>The wand is kind of weird, but not necessarily in a bad way. It&#8217;s kind of wobbly &#8211; not really sure how or why, but it has a lot of give to it, which actually makes getting all those small lashes much easier. The full brush is pretty much idiot-proof &#8211; you won&#8217;t struggle with clumping, and the formula is excellent. I didn&#8217;t experience any flaking or smudging (I hate it when I look like a raccoon at the end of the day &#8211; or night), and it didn&#8217;t wear away into nothing in an hour.</p>
<p>A very solid mascara, and I would absolutely purchase it again. This is my first Maybelline mascara in quite awhile, and I&#8217;m really glad that they are moving beyond Great Lash, because I never understood the love for that formula at all (go ahead and throw tomatoes, but I&#8217;m not afraid to say it &#8211; that formula is crap on me).</p>

<p>There are three included step-by-step looks, and I created the Classic and Fashion looks. They were super easy to do, and the colors are gorgeous.</p>
<div id="attachment_32746" class="wp-caption aligncenter" style="width: 610px"><a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.retrodivamedia.com%2Fbeauty%2Fwp-content%2Fuploads%2F2013%2F06%2Fboudoireyesretrodiva2.jpg&sref=rss"><img class="size-full wp-image-32746" alt="boudoir eyes too faced retrodiva" src="http://www.retrodivamedia.com/beauty/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/boudoireyesretrodiva2.jpg" width="600" height="454"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Classic look</p></div>
<p>The Classic look is perfect for day wear, as it&#8217;s not glittery, too shimmery, or too bright. It&#8217;s more subdued than the Fashion look.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">To get the Classic look</span>:</p>
<ul>
<li><span style="line-height: 13px;">Start with an eye primer (<a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F116KlPy&sref=rss">Too Faced Shadow Insurance</a> is supposed to be fab), and apply it all over the lid.</span></li>
<li>Apply Satin Sheets, a lightly shimmery neutral, from lash to brow with a fluffy eyeshadow brush (I like Vincent Longo&#8217;s <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F11j6M2g&sref=rss">Large Eyeshadow Brush</a>).</li>
<li>Next, sweep Sugar Walls onto lid, crease, and around the tear duct. I used a small smudge brush to get it around my tear duct, and it was perfect (Sephora&#8217;s <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F11j3lso&sref=rss">Smudge Brush</a>).</li>
<li>Smoke out the eyes with the darkest shade in the row, Garter Belt. Line under the eye and on the upper lash line, and blend outward. Bring it to a point in the outer corner of your eye.</li>
</ul>
<div id="attachment_32747" class="wp-caption aligncenter" style="width: 610px"><a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.retrodivamedia.com%2Fbeauty%2Fwp-content%2Fuploads%2F2013%2F06%2Fboudoireyesretrodiva.jpg&sref=rss"><img class="size-full wp-image-32747" title="boudoir eyes too faced palette" alt="boudoir eyes too faced palette" src="http://www.retrodivamedia.com/beauty/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/boudoireyesretrodiva.jpg" width="600" height="535"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Fashion look</p></div>
<p>The Fashion look is perfect for evening, and you can build on the colors to achieve the intensity that you want.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">To get the Fashion Look</span>:</p>
<ul>
<li>Start with primer all over the eyelid.</li>
<li>Apply Birthday Suit all over the lid, from lash line to brow bone.</li>
<li>Blend Lap Dance into the crease and into the lid. A specialized crease brush like <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F1bBnChg&sref=rss">Hourglass&#8217; Crease Brush #4</a> really helps with this.</li>
<li>Apply French Tickler, the darkest shade, to the upper lash line and extend outward.</li>
<li>Blend French Tickler into the lower lash line, and be sure to smoke it out by blending outward.</li>
</ul>

<p>First, let me say that these eye shadows are AMAZING. They are so easy to work with and highly pigmented. You can build color easily, and blending is a dream. Included are three different looks that are super easy to recreate, and I picked the &#8220;R Rated&#8221; look to wear out. Following the steps is pretty much idiot-proof, and I&#8217;ll break it down for you here:</p>
<ol>
<li><span style="line-height: 13px;">Apply the champagne-colored primer over the entire eye. This has a bit of shimmer to it, and it&#8217;s creamy. Use your concealer brush (in the spirit of the palette, try <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F14ujnDL&sref=rss">Kat Von D&#8217;s Concealer Brush</a>) and prime that eyelid up.</span></li>
<li>Apply Blue Angel eyeshadow on entire lid, and up through the crease. You will want to create depth at the outer corners by applying more shadow there.</li>
<li>Take the included black pencil eyeliner and line right at the lash line. Use a heavy hand here &#8211; we didn&#8217;t skimp on our black eyeliner in the 80s. Smudge it out after you get it on.</li>
<li>Take an angled shadow brush (I like mine to be small and somewhat stiff &#8211; not as stiff as an eyebrow brush, but you get the idea &#8211; try the <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F1brKGyZ&sref=rss">Sonia Kashuk Angled Eye Shadow Brush</a>) and apply the Cauldron Smoke gray color to your smudged eyeliner. Blend upwards on your lid and downwards on your lower lash line to create a smoky eye.</li>
<li>Using a clean shadow brush, apply the Hot Hot Pink to the inner corner of your eyes, and blend out to the middle of the lid. I also applied it on the inner corner of my lower lash lines too, just for fun.</li>
<li>Blend, and then blend more. Apply more color as needed. Then blend again. Seriously.</li>
<li>Apply three coats of a nice thick mascara, like <a href="http://redirectingat.com?id=52039X1266151&xs=1&url=http%3A%2F%2Fbit.ly%2F1brLNPm&sref=rss">Cover Girl&#8217;s Professional Super Thick Lash Mascara</a>.</li>
</ol>
<p>Overall, I love this palette. The colors are wild and fun, it&#8217;s a vegan and cruelty-free formula, and the price is right. It looks as if they have changed the palette a bit by adding some new colors, lashes, and lip colors.</p>
